Locks an object or endpoint at its current coordinate, preventing the object or point from moving when constraints are applied.

Note: The fixed object or point can be moved while editing geometry, but will not move when constraints are placed upon it.

  1. To fix an object, activate the Fix Geometry constraint and select the object you want to fix.
    Image Removed Image Added
    The anchor symbol indicates that the object is fixed.
    Image Removed Image Added
  2. Now if you apply a constraint, such as Parallel in this case, the non-fixed line will move, regardless of the selection order.
    Image Removed Image Added
  3. For another example of this tool, start with a line and arc and apply a Connect constraint (see Connect Constraint).
    Image Removed Image Added
  4. The result is that the line maintains its orientation and is tangent and trimmed to the arc.
    Image Removed Image Added
  5. Undo this constraint, and apply a Fix Geometry constraint to the line's endpoint.
    Image Removed Image Added
    Now the anchor symbol is attached to the endpoint.
    Image Removed Image Added
  6. Now apply the Connect constraint. The endpoint stays fixed, and the orientations of the line and arc are modified.
    Image Removed Image Added
  7. If you edit the line or arc, such as changing start or end angles, the fixed point will not move, and the other objects will move or rotate accordingly.
